Output 8fb5e4421eb0e5002849180973d1671a181961cb9f31baeb293c750f7222a49e:0

value
478967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a42144220fdbe5a945d0ea107a75316a98bece4 OP_EQUAL
address
32dFqikxpee9ys7dETrMiHDoA4hH6MjHeQ
transaction
8fb5e4421eb0e5002849180973d1671a181961cb9f31baeb293c750f7222a49e
confirmations
321753
spent
true